Telecom Department has made this special plan; Fake calls coming from abroad will be disconnected automatically

These days people are getting many fraud calls. These calls are made by cyber criminals operating from abroad, they are skilled in these cyber crimes. These are foreign numbers, but they appear to be Indian mobile numbers. The Ministry of Communications has now begun to disrupt the conspiracy of these cyber criminals who are based in other countries. A special system is being developed to prevent fake calls from abroad from reaching consumers. It is worth noting that over one crore calls from abroad are received each day for cybercrime or fraud.

Every day, approximately 45 lakh calls are blocked by telecom companies. According to the department, such a centralized system will be implemented soon, with the goal of completely preventing calls for cybercrime from abroad. Actually, cyber criminals based abroad use calling line identities to conceal their true identities.

According to the Department of Communications, the Digital Intelligence Platform (DIP) has been launched to combat cybercrime. So that the use of telecom resources for financial fraud and cybercrime can be prevented.
